Ticket: DEDUP-412 — Connection failures during customer record dedup

The Larkspur dedup job started failing overnight with pool exhaustion errors. It merges duplicate customer records in batches of 500, but the batch worker isn't releasing connections after a merge conflict, so the pool drains within twenty minutes. Proposed fix: wrap merges in a try/finally release and cap retries at three. For the sync, reproduce against staging using the connection string below.

primary connection of bagep-kaweg = clickhouse://rusdor_svc:3TXlgH7O8DuUYI@db-ae3f.zarqelgrid.internal:5432/zordor

Shuttle-bus gate — reception notes

The Harlowe Park shuttle stops at Gate C every twenty minutes, 07:00–19:00. Reception staff open the gate for drivers only; passengers wait behind the yellow line. If the gate jams, call facilities — do not force it. Log each opening in the gate book. Release the gate with the code below.

door code, yagap-bahof: bdg-O-05

Subject: Handover — TelemPack release duties

Hi,

Taking over from me this week: TelemPack v1.9 compresses telemetry payloads with the new dictionary codec. Please watch decompression error rates on the Brindle cluster for 48 hours post-deploy, and hold the rollout if they exceed baseline. All release artifacts must be verified before promotion. For that verification, use the current signing key below.

signing key of hahag-tahag = bky4_v18e

Welcome to GraphNibble! Since you'll be reviewing PRs here, a quick primer: GraphNibble renders dependency graphs for the Plover build system, and most changes touch the layout engine in `render/dag.rs`. To actually see the graphs locally, you'll want the metadata cache populated, otherwise everything renders as sad gray boxes. The cache loader reads node metadata straight from our staging store. Point your local config at the staging database using the connection string below.

primary connection of yagep-kahip = redis://giliel_svc:zYiKsLL2PLpfPL@db-348f.xolmarsys.corp:5432/fenwyn